Why These Are the Top HVAC Contractors in Troy

The HVAC market in Troy, TX, is characterized by high demand for reliable air conditioning due to long, hot, and humid summers. Winters are generally mild but can have cold snaps, creating a need for functional heating systems. The market consists of a mix of a few long-standing local companies and larger regional providers serving the area. Homeowners prioritize system reliability, energy efficiency to combat high cooling costs, and contractors who offer responsive emergency service, especially during the peak summer season.
